“…Furthermore, as there have been no known downhole geothermal explorations and data for the various sites in Nigeria, it is perhaps impossible to fully ascertain a 500 MW estimate, particularly an estimate based on temperature [18]. In fact, in [19], and buttressing the work of [9], it was determined that parts of the Niger Delta Basin, in which sig-Open Access Library Journal nificant oil and gas drilling has occurred, has heat flow values of less than 100 mW/m 2 (100 mW/m 2 being the minimum standard for a viable geothermal source).…”

“…Mono et al (2018) estimated CPD values, heat flow, and geothermal gradient from spectral analysis of magnetic anomalies in the Loum-Minta region, Cameroun. Using aeromagnetic maps, Chukwu et al (2018) determined CPD and heat flow values for the Niger Delta Basin of Nigeria. Özer andPolat (2017a, 2017b) investigated the relation among seismic velocity, Curie depth, heat flow, and geothermal resources.…”
